Now, the same for Austria.

Austrian order of precedence:

Maria - Theresia Militärorden
Order of the Iron Crown, 1st class
Order of the Iron Crown, 2nd class
Order of the Iron Crown, 3rd class
Grand Cross of the order of Leopold with diamonds and swords
Grand Cross of the order of Leopold with swords
Cross First Class of the order of Leopold with swords
Commander's cross of the order of Leopold with swords
Knight's cross of the order of Leopold with swords
Grand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ords and war decoration
Grand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Grand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with war decoration
Commander's Star of the order of Franz Joseph with swords and war decoration
Commander's Star of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Commander's Star of the order of Franz Joseph with war decoration
Commander's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ords and war decoration
Commander's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Commander's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with war decoration
Officer's Cross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ords and war decoration
Officer's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Officer's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with war decoration
Knight's Cross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ords and war decoration
Knight's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Knight's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with war decoration
Military Merit Cross, 1st class (pinback cross) with swords and war decoration
Military Merit Cross, 1st class (pinback cross) with swords
Military Merit Cross, 1st class (pinback cross)
Large Military Merit Medal - usually only awarded to generals. Will disregard that one.
Military Merit Cross, 2nd class (neck badge) with swords and war decoration
Military Merit Cross, 2nd class (neck badge) with swords
Military Merit Cross, 2nd class (neck badge)
Military Merit Cross, 3rd class (ribbon) with swords and war decoration
Military Merit Cross, 3rd class (ribbon) with swords
Military Merit Cross, 3rd class (ribbon)
Military Merit Medal (silver) with swords
Military Merit Medal (silver)
Military Merit Medal (bronze) with swords
Military Merit Medal (bronze)
Wound Medal
u-boat war pin? Did it ever exist? I don't know.


Here is my suggestion for the ten medals we can achieve:

IC2 - Military Merit Cross, 3rd class (ribbon)
IC1 - Military Merit Cross, 3rd class (ribbon) with swords and war decoration
U-Boot war badge - U-boot war pin (if it ever existed) otherwise replace it with military merit medal/wound badge
U-boot front clasp: Military Merit Medal (bronze)
German Cross: Knight's Cross Cross of the order of Franz Joseph with swords
Knight's Cross: Knight's cross of the order of Leopold with swords
Knight's Cross with oak leaves: Commander's cross of the order of Leopold with swords
Knights cross with oak leaves and swords:
Cross First Class of the order of Leopold with swords
Knights cross with swords, oak leaves and diamonds: Order of the iron crown, third class
Knights cross with golden oak leaves, swords and diamonds: Maria-Theresia Militärorden


I am however a bit unhappy with the Austrian -Hungarian situation. They do not really have a clear order of precedence, and very few actual orders. And the Order of franz joseph is actually more of an order for distinguished service than for bravery. This is however the best I can do.

Mate - first off, your sig is breaking the page. Second, did you look through the medals? Most of them are not egligible for the time period.


* Order of the Golden Fleece - only awarded to nobility and royalty
* Military Order of Maria Theresa
* Royal Hungarian Order of St Stefan - only awarded to military and people with the rank of general
* Military Merit Cross
* Order of Leopold
* Order of the Iron Crown
* Order of Franz Joseph
* Order of Elisabeth - only awarded to women
* Order of the Starry Cross - nope.
* Teutonic Order - a catholic order, no relation to war
* Decoration for Art and Science - WTF?
* War Cross for Civil Merit, 1915 - Civil merit. Meaning logistics, fundraising etc.
* Large Bravery Medal for Officers - Actually that is the large merit medal, awarded for generals.
* Elizabeth-Theresa Military Decoration - discontinued, iirc.
* Cross for Religious Service - wtf?
* Cross for Religious Service on War Ribbon - wtf?
* Military Merit Medal (Signum Laudis)
* Military Merit Medal (Signum Laudis) on War Ribbon
* Civil Merit Medal (Civil Signum Laudis)
* Bravery Medal
* Merit Cross
* Merit Cross on War Ribbon
* Elizabeth Merit Cross - see above
* Elizabeth Merit Medal - see above
* War Medal 1873 - look at the year.
* Army Cross 1813-14 (Cannon Cross) - outdated
* Civil Honour Cross 1813-14 - outdated
* Bohemian Nobles' Cross 1814 - outdated
* Tirol Huldigung Medal 1834 - outdated
* Tirol Medal 1848 - outdated
* 50th Anniversary Medal for the Defence of the Tirol - outdated
* Commemorative Medal for the 1864 campaign against Denmark - outdated
* Tirol Medal 1866 - outdated
* Cross of Merit
* Iron Cross of Merit
* Commemorative Medal for 50th Anniversary of Franz Joseph's Reign for the Army - outdated
* Commemorative Medal for 50th Anniversary of Franz Joseph's Reign for Military - outdated Widows
* Commemorative Medal for 50th Anniversary of Franz Joseph's Reign for Civil Servants - outdated
* Commemorative Cross for 60th Anniversary of Franz Joseph's Reign - outdated
* Commemorative Cross 1912-13 - outdated
* Karl Troop Cross - only awarded to the army
* Long Service Cross for NCOs for 12 Years Service - outdated
* Wound Medal
* Honour Decoration of the Red Cross 1914-18 - so you think a Uboot was working as a doctor?
* Honour Badge of the Red Cross - so you think a Uboot was working as a doctor?
* Red Cross Medal - so you think a Uboot was working as a doctor?
* Merit Award of the Red Cross 1914 - so you think a Uboot was working as a doctor?
* Commemorative Medal of the 13th Royal Bavarian Infantry - yeah, right. Uboat - infantry?

Mate, really, did you just copy paste stuff? Cause it really doesn't look like you spent a lot of time dwelling on what you just wrote.
